The Opportunity:
- Providing day-to-day quality engineering support to manufacturing operations and ensuring timely resolution of quality issues.
- Leading structured root cause investigations using recognised problem-solving methodologies including 5 Why, Fishbone, DMAIC and 8D.
- Supporting change control activities, risk assessments, verification and validation processes to ensure compliance and quality standards are maintained.
- Conducting Measurement System Analysis (MSA), Gage R&R studies and statistical analysis to drive data-led decision making.
- Leading and supporting continuous improvement projects focused on process capability, defect reduction, yield improvement and operational excellence.
Your work will directly contribute to product quality, regulatory compliance, manufacturing efficiency and positive customer outcomes.
About You:
- Degree-level qualification in Engineering, Science or a related technical discipline.
- Experience working within a regulated industry, ideally within medical devices or a similarly controlled environment.
- Strong understanding of quality engineering principles including root cause analysis, validation, risk management and statistical methods.
- Experience using Six Sigma tools such as MSA, SPC, DOE, capability analysis and structured problem-solving techniques.
- Excellent communication skills with the ability to build effective relationships across operational, engineering and quality teams.
- A proactive, analytical and collaborative approach, with a passion for continuous improvement and delivering high standards.
